Sestertius, ca. 140–144. Obverse: Bust of Antoninus Pius in cloak (paludamentum) with laurel wreath, facing right; inscription ANTONINVS AVG PI - VS PP TR P COS III. Reverse: Bust of young Marcus Aurelius in cloak (paludamentum), without headgear, facing right; inscription AVRELIV, CAESAR AVG PII F COS and below the portrait SC. Roman Empire; Rome. Coin: bronze; diameter 35.5–36.0 mm; weight 29.78 g; axis 15°. Subjects: Antoninus Pius (86–161; Roman emperor 138–161), Marcus Aurelius (121–180; Roman emperor 161–180; caesar 139–161). Iconography: heads, paludamentum.
